Job description

Description: As a data scientist specializing in graph analysis and algorithms, you will join a collaborative team building an entirely new graph analysis platform that, for the first time, will allow our mission customers to visualize, analyze, and traverse their expansive and complex mission data in graph format and in near-real-time. Your responsibilities will center around enhancing our graph data capabilities-designing, modeling, and optimizing complex graph structures and crafting performant database queries. While familiarity with Neo4j and its query language, Cypher, is beneficial, we welcome candidates with broader graph analysis experience who are eager to deepen their expertise. You may also develop and maintain data parsers using Python to support our ingestion pipelines and maintain comprehensive documentation of data models. Finally, you will work directly with mission analysts and operators to listen to their needs and address them through novel data models and graphing solutions.
